首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

忽略Google Sheets自定义脚本中的空单元格

是指在使用Google Sheets自定义脚本时,不将空单元格包括在脚本的操作范围内,从而避免处理空单元格时可能出现的错误。

在Google Sheets中,自定义脚本是一种用户自定义的功能,可以通过JavaScript编写,用于扩展Google Sheets的功能。当涉及到处理数据时,脚本通常需要遍历工作表中的单元格,并执行特定的操作。然而,有时候工作表中存在空单元格,如果不进行适当处理,可能会导致脚本出现错误。

要忽略Google Sheets自定义脚本中的空单元格,可以使用条件语句来判断单元格是否为空,如果为空则跳过该单元格的处理。以下是一个示例脚本:

代码语言:txt
复制
function processCells() {
  var sheet = SpreadsheetApp.getActiveSpreadsheet().getActiveSheet();
  var range = sheet.getDataRange();
  var values = range.getValues();

  for (var row = 0; row < values.length; row++) {
    for (var col = 0; col < values[row].length; col++) {
      var cellValue = values[row][col];
      
      if (cellValue !== "") {
        // 处理非空单元格
        // ...
      }
    }
  }
}

在这个示例中,getValues()方法用于获取工作表中的所有值,并存储在values数组中。接下来,使用双重循环遍历每个单元格,并使用条件语句判断单元格的值是否为空。如果单元格不为空,则执行相应的操作。

需要注意的是,以上示例仅演示了如何忽略空单元格,实际应用中的操作可能会根据具体需求而有所不同。同时,可以根据具体场景选择适合的腾讯云产品进行扩展和支持,例如:

  1. 数据库:腾讯云云数据库 MySQL(产品介绍:https://cloud.tencent.com/product/cdb)
  2. 服务器运维:腾讯云轻量应用服务器(产品介绍:https://cloud.tencent.com/product/lighthouse)
  3. 云原生:腾讯云容器服务 TKE(产品介绍:https://cloud.tencent.com/product/tke)
  4. 网络安全:腾讯云Web应用防火墙(产品介绍:https://cloud.tencent.com/product/waf)
  5. 人工智能:腾讯云人脸识别 API(产品介绍:https://cloud.tencent.com/product/face-recognition)
  6. 物联网:腾讯云物联网套件(产品介绍:https://cloud.tencent.com/product/iot-suite)
  7. 移动开发:腾讯云移动推送 TPNS(产品介绍:https://cloud.tencent.com/product/tpns)
  8. 存储:腾讯云对象存储 COS(产品介绍:https://cloud.tencent.com/product/cos)
  9. 区块链:腾讯云区块链服务(产品介绍:https://cloud.tencent.com/product/tbaas)
  10. 元宇宙:腾讯云虚拟现实云服务(产品介绍:https://cloud.tencent.com/product/vr)。

通过结合以上腾讯云产品和技术,可以实现更加全面和完善的云计算解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券